Are you a relationship-driven banking leader who enjoys coaching teams, growing customer relationships, and making a visible impact in the community? The Merrimack is seeking a Branch & Business Development Manager to lead our branch in Henniker, New Hampshire. This role is ideal for an experienced branch banking professional who thrives in a leadership role that blends team development, business development, customer service, lending support, operational oversight, and community engagement.

In This Role, You Will
- Lead branch performance, daily operations, customer experience, and growth initiatives
- Coach, motivate, and develop branch team members while fostering accountability, teamwork, and continuous improvement
- Build strong customer relationships through needs-based conversations, referrals, and relationship-driven service
- Represent the bank in the community through business development, local involvement, and partnership-building
- Support consumer, equity, and small business lending needs while maintaining strong product and service knowledge
- Ensure compliance with bank policies, procedures, security standards, and applicable legal and regulatory requirements
- Participate in branch sales, strategic planning, budgeting, and goal achievement
- Partner with HR on hiring, performance management, employee development, and related employment matters
- Open and close the branch on a rotating basis and support additional branch needs as requested
What We're Looking For
- Three to five years of related banking, branch operations, sales, business development, or leadership experience, or an equivalent combination of education and experience
- Previous supervisory or management experience with a proven ability to coach and develop others
- Strong commitment to relationship selling, quality service, and community banking
- Excellent communication, problem-solving, analytical, and negotiation skills
- Knowledge of branch operations, consumer lending, bank policies, procedures, and regulatory requirements
- Ability to manage multiple priorities, take initiative, and adapt in a changing environment
- Proficiency with desktop applications and general office equipment
- Ability to travel to other branches, departments, local businesses and business development meetings
- Ability to work Saturdays when scheduled
